Transaction 6efc5df6761b111bab3bb145bb9145c4d51c0766b5c0687e4a8df5f0e0760899
1 Input
1 Output
-
6efc5df6761b111bab3bb145bb9145c4d51c0766b5c0687e4a8df5f0e0760899:0
- value
- 294785
- script pubkey
- OP_0 OP_PUSHBYTES_20 85841774df87b5a5b36939b7213b465236b891fa
- address
- bc1qskzpwaxls766tvmf8xmjzw6x2gmt3y06qwr53g